Tumor-on-a-chip: a micro-architecture to explore the interaction between cancer and immune cells
Biology is complex. We need models to make it simpler. We can test anti-cancer drugs on tumor cell cultures, but they are anything like a “real” tumor: that resembles an “ecosystem”, where multiple cell populations coexist and interact with each other. In a paper published on Cell, scientists managed to bring that complexity…on a chip! Not only they reproduced the 3D micro-architecture of the tumor microenvironment, but they also characterize the response to an immunomodulatory drug.
